Cambodia national cricket team
The Cambodian national cricket team There is no National cricket team that represents the nation of Cambodia in international cricket competitions that is administered by the Cricket Association of Cambodia. In Dec 2021 Cricket Federation Cambodia Association (CFCA) is established as a Local Non-profit, Non-governmental Sports association to govern the cricket activities at National and International Levels. Most of the Federation Board members are Local Cambodian those took initiative to form a Legal and constitutional body that can perform the activities in Cambodia. Cricket Federation Cambodia (CFCA) got its Legal Status on 3rd Dec 2021 through Parkas No 3159PRK by Ministry of interior Royal government of Cambodia. The Cricket Federation Cambodia Association (CFCA) gained the international Membership of ICWC International Council for wheelchair Cricket and in its beginning got an opportunity to represent its National Wheelchair Cricket Team at T-20 ASIA CUP to be Held in Pakistan in 2023.[1][2]

Cambodia applied for Asian Cricket Council membership, which was granted in 2012.[3] The Cricket Association also plans to apply for membership of the National Olympic Committee. Unfortunately, there was not development happened since 2012 and latter this membership was suspended.
Cricket in the former French colony of Cambodia is still a mainly expatriate game at senior level, and a growing interest with the younger set of boys that play. Additionally, a structured cricket league is being planned in the country with the help of the Thailand Cricket League and that the National Stadium, Phnom Penh and Army Stadium will be available. Cambodia is planned to host the 2023 Southeast Asian Games and a cricket ground could be funded and built.[4] A cricket ground 10km from the capital began construction and was expected to be ready by October 2014.[5]
The Cricket Association planned to join the International Cricket Council as an Affiliate Member in 2013,[6] but in 2014 it was reported that this was some way in the future yet.[5] In March 2020, the Cambodia Cricket Association announced that a Cambodia Board XI team would tour Singapore in April 2020 to play three T20 matches, to prepare for associate ICC membership.[7][8]
Cricket Federation Cambodia Announced its First International cricket Event dedicated to its Prime Minister Hun Sen "Samdech Hun Sen Asia Peace Cup 2022" to be held in Nov 2022 in Phnom Penh, Cambodia. This is the first cricket tournament in the history of Cricket of Cambodia. This tournament will be played between more than 10 Asian Countries Like India, Pakistan, Bangladesh, Srilanka, Afghanistan, Nepal, Thailand, Vietnam, Laos and many other countries may join it tournament. Samdech Hun Sen Asia peace cup will be played as Tennis Cricket and Para Cricket Teams from these participating Countries. This announcement was made through a press conference in Phnom Penh on 21st April 2022 after formal acceptance of the proposal by His Excellency Yi Vesana Advisor to Royal Government of Kingdom of Cambodia and Secretary General of National Paralympic Committee of Cambodia. HE Yi Vesana is also Honorary Chairman of Cricket Federation Cambodia Association.[9]
